What Ace of Wands signals in this area
The Ace of Wands, when appearing in a reading about wellbeing and health, often points to a fresh burst of energy and a new beginning. Physically, it can suggest a renewed vitality, perhaps the start of a new fitness routine or a sudden motivation to improve one's diet. It’s about igniting that inner spark for better physical health.
For mental clarity, this card indicates a breakthrough in thought, a new idea or perspective that brings focus and direction. It might signal the end of a period of mental fog, making way for clearer decision-making and problem-solving. It’s the inspiration for a new mental approach.
In self-care and rest, the Ace of Wands encourages initiating new, beneficial practices. This isn't about passive rest, but an active decision to implement routines that genuinely support your wellbeing. It could be a new hobby for stress relief or a committed effort to improve sleep hygiene.
Regarding emotional balance, it signals the potential for a fresh emotional outlook. Perhaps you're finding new ways to process feelings or are ready to embark on a journey towards greater emotional resilience. It's the impetus to proactively manage your emotional landscape, rather than reacting to it.
When Ace of Wands appears reversed
When the Ace of Wands appears reversed in a wellbeing and health context, it often suggests a blockage or delay in these new beginnings. Physically, this might manifest as a lack of motivation to start a new health regime, or a feeling of being stuck despite wanting to improve. Energy levels might be low, or new ventures are simply not getting off the ground.
For mental clarity, a reversed Ace of Wands can indicate creative blocks or a struggle to find a new perspective. Ideas might feel scattered, or there's a difficulty in committing to a clear mental path. It can point to frustration with a lack of inspiration or direction.
In self-care and rest, the reversed card might mean missed opportunities for self-care, or an inability to initiate beneficial routines. There could be a feeling of being overwhelmed by the idea of starting something new for your wellbeing.
Emotionally, it can signal a hesitancy to address emotional issues or a difficulty in finding the spark to move forward from emotional stagnation. It suggests potential for growth is there, but something is holding it back from manifesting.
